The PSAT/NMSQT can play a role in your future academic success. The exam focuses on the core concepts and skills that you will need in order to make it through your educational career. The test consists of sections on Reading, Math, and Writing and Language. The exam is less about memorizing key information and more about your ability to apply the concepts to real-world examples. In addition to reviewing the concepts covered on the PSAT, your instructor can help you build your readiness for the format, types of questions, and other aspects of the exam to cut down on potential surprises on the day of the test. For instance, there are multiple-choice questions based on passages covered in the Reading section. You will need to manage your time effectively to complete the section within the hour-long time limit. Your instructor can go over skimming techniques that can help you identify important information as you work. They can show you ways that you can eliminate potentially incorrect responses, as well as strategies that can help you ease any test-related anxiety.
